node.js - ES6 React server-side rendering, how to import a React Component? -


i'm transpiling es6 es5.

  1. babeljs nodejs express server files , server-side rendering output directory build/server/.
  2. browserify + babelify reactcomponents output build/client/bundle.js file

when trying import react component build/client/bundle.js build/server/ file app crashes because i'm importing untranspiled reactcomponent.

how import reactcomponent without duplicating code in server (re-using code client/bundle.js)?

you have few solutions:

  • your server code doesn't need pre-compiled. if run babel-node, compiled on-the-fly.

  • you bundle server code. don't know resource on how browserify, here's resource started webpack backend.

  • you build client code alongside server code.


Comments

Popular posts from this blog

angularjs - ADAL JS Angular- WebAPI add a new role claim to the token -

php - CakePHP HttpSockets send array of paramms -

node.js - Using Node without global install -